Otherwise referred to as cash advance loans, payday loans are short-term, high-interest loans mostly taken out to address immediate or urgent money problems between salary payments! As the name may suggest, the loan is designed in such a way that it should be repaid on the next payday. More and more people are getting attracted to payday loans because of their fast approval and easy application process.

Because they are available and can be accessible entirely online, most people find it very easy to apply for one when an urgent money problem presents itself. Sadly, it is not always all rosy for all applicants. Despite the fact that there are genuine payday loans lenders out there, some unscrupulous dealers are also available, looking to rip you off your hard earned cash. How do you therefore ensure that you get a good deal on the internet?

Taking your time to conduct thorough research on the lending institution you plan to work with will save you so much trouble and heartaches. Ensure you review the cash advance terms and conditions and that you read and understand the fine print before appending your signature on any legally binding agreements. Your thorough background research will help ensure the company you are dealing with is in good financial standing and that it is reputable and trust worthy.

For starters, you can check with the Better Business Bureau website to see whether there are any negative reports made, and if yes, how they were resolved. You might also want to check on Payday loans online forums to see what others are saying about the online payday service provider you are planning to work with. At this time and age when sharing of information is a mouse click away, more and more people who are dissatisfied with the level of service they get often find it easy and worthwhile to warn other members by posting on online social networks and forums.

Long-term debt a real issue

Many people, especially in the United States depend on payday loans to cater for their budget deficit before the next payday. In the United States 37 states have legalized the payday loan hence its wide usage by Americans. Other countries where payday loan is common is Canada, Australia and the United Kingdom. This is because payday lenders provide relief in between pay periods, especially to the poor masses who can hardly afford to get alternative bank credits due to credit constraints.

These are small, short-term and unsecured loans - that is only secured against a customer's next pay check. Overtime, the world of credit and lending has transformed from manual via lending stores to online lending where one simply applies for the loan online, gets an approval, then receives the cash through his or her bank account. The fee plus the amount borrowed is then electronically deducted from the customer's account as soon as the customer gets paid by the employer.

However, it's not all rosy and has its thorns. The sector has been characterised by many critics as being predatory. This is because of the high interest payable by customers compared to the other credit services. The fact they target the poor population; it is seen as draining money from the poor population. Lenders also ignore legal restrictions by charging very high interest rates, higher than that sanctioned by law. It is for this reason that credit is either illegal or unviable in 13 states in the United States. In addition, this creates a debt cycle where the poor become dependent on this loan instead of working towards managing the available resources and saving up. The lenders take advantage of their economic hardships to make a profit.

It is therefore the responsibility of an individual to examine various loan options and make an informed decision as to whether to take a payday loan. Though to the poor and young population, who face credit constraint, such options can be slim or non-existent, pay check cash advances from employers or loans from family and friends are viable options. Qualifying

There are several requirements that you need meet before applying for this facility. First off, you must be 18 years or older. In addition, you must have a job or a regular source of income of around £800 to £1000 per month. Finally, you need have valid identification documents as well as a bank account. Payday lenders do not do credit checks, so you need not to worry about your credit score.

The application process

Applying for online loans is very easy because all you need is internet access. Once you have identified the right lender, you will be required to fill out a simple form online. This takes only a few minutes. The approval time is also very fast, often no more than 24 hours from the time of application. However, before rushing through the application process, be sure to read and understand the lender's disclosure information. Pay much attention to the interest rates and fees as well as the repayment terms. Once your application has been approved, you will receive an email or phone notification informing you that the money has been deposited into your bank account. These loans are usually available for up to £1500.

Repaying your loan

Most companies will require you to repay your debt before your next payday. However, some lenders can allow you to make your repayment in installments of up to two months, especially when the borrowed amount is greater than your monthly income. Most often, the lender will automatically withdraw the money plus the corresponding charges from your account on the due date. Defaulting in your repayment can attract fines besides tainting your credit score, hence be sure to repay your loan when it is due.
